How Much Does a Radiologic Technologist Make Radiologic Technologists made a median salary of 65 140 in 2022 The best paid 25 made 80 050 that year while the lowest paid 25 made 57 350 Radiologic Technologist Salaries by State This sortable radiology tech salary and job outlook table provides key data for individuals interested in starting a career as a radiologic technologist You will find the average annual salary for radiologic technologists in your state as well as the projected growth rate for radiologic and diagnostic tech jobs in all categories from 2020 to 2030
